Over 175 Students Participate in the First Workshop of the Autentico Culinary Festival
3
VIEWS

On Friday, October 10, more than 175 students from Colegio EPI, EPB Oranjestad, and EPB San Nicolas took part in the first educational workshop of the Autentico Culinary Festival. This activation is part of the Culinary Education Plan, an initiative by the Aruba Tourism Authority (A.T.A.) in collaboration with the festival. The workshop offered students a real-world glimpse into the culinary industry and served as an inspiring platform for their future careers.

Throughout the program, students gained valuable knowledge from various industry professionals. Chef Aldwin Donata, an Executive Chef, encouraged students to pursue careers in the culinary arts, sharing his personal journey and the dedication required for success.

Lorraine Cooyman led a session titled “From Farm to Table”, highlighting the importance of sustainability and local produce in gastronomy. Drawing from her own experience as a farmer, Cooyman introduced students to microgreens, allowing them to taste and take samples home for a hands-on farm-to-table experience.

Zaida Everon, a bread sommelier, demonstrated how bread can enhance the culinary experience. She showcased different bread pairings with local dishes and explained various baking techniques. The session was interactive, as students touched, observed, and tasted the famous sourdough bread.

Jessika Theysen, a wine sommelier, taught students how to pair wines with different dishes and emphasized that serving wine is not just a gesture but an experience that leaves a lasting impression.

The program concluded with Chef Jean Claude Werleman, who performed a live dessert-making demonstration. His session showcased how creativity and technique are essential in preparing desserts and pastries. At the end, students who correctly answered his questions were rewarded with a chance to taste the dessert.

The Aruba Tourism Authority (A.T.A.) expressed gratitude to all presenters for their valuable contributions and to the participating schools for their active involvement in this successful educational initiative.
